I just did my rear shocks this morning... my old ones were shot! I put in some new "monrowe" shocks (don't remember if thats how you spell it" from advanced autoparts... It was the best ones that they had in stock at the time... 5 star rating for $28.00 bucks for one... Took about a hour to do and next week im going to do my front struts... because there shot as well...

very very simple to do your self... only two bolts...

did notice a big improvement on ride quailty... there not bad for the money! i just needed something now, and i didnt want to wait on someone ship me some!

Lil update... just did the front struts! little bit of a pain but not bad to do... got the top nut off no problem but the bottom bolts wouldnt come off.... i broke two sockets and bent two breaker bars! only way i got them off was to heat them up... and got a stronger breaker bar and bam they came loose! both sides were like that! havent gone for a ride... but the right side was orginal strut and left they replaced? but it should be good to go now!
